The function and working principle of wiper
The main function of the wiper is to remove rain, snow, dust and other debris on the windshield under rainy or foggy weather conditions to maintain a clear vision of the driver. It drives the linkage mechanism through a motor to make the wiper blade reciprocate on the windshield, thereby realizing the function of wiping.

The working principle of the wiper is seemingly simple, but it involves knowledge in many fields such as mechanics, electronics and materials. The motor provides power to convert the rotary motion into the reciprocating linear motion of the wiper blade through the linkage mechanism. The wiper blade is usually made of rubber, and its adhesion to the windshield and the quality of the rubber directly affect the wiper effect.
